Danilo Gallinari retires after 14 NBA seasons

Veteran forward Danilo Gallinari, the No. 6 pick in the 2008 NBA Draft, announced his retirement on December 2, 2025, via social media. The 37-year-old Italian ends his career as the highest-scoring player from Italy in NBA history with 11,607 points. Gallinari played for eight NBA teams over 14 seasons, known for his 3-point shooting as a 6-foot-10 forward.
